Transaction 764647b573b29ce64cb27e5c29b1198d0806776ffd455ea55bb70dc5473b467b

2 Input
1 Outputs
  • 764647b573b29ce64cb27e5c29b1198d0806776ffd455ea55bb70dc5473b467b:0
  • value  27983672
    address  1G4LeE7KwAL2azGcP5oTTzc9aCH9KiDTXj